[1]Two segments this week:
First, Chris gives a shout out to Sociological Images for their post on Push Up Bikini Tops at Abercrombie Kids [2], which inspires a discussion about gender and childhood culture.
Second, a discussion about Ebooks, Amazon, DRM, and the fate of public knowledge.

[1]This week we talk about the sociology and economics of academic journal publishing, the Elsevier boycott [2], and whether the journal system as we know it is necessary anymore. Our decision: everybody can just podcast everything from now on. Starting with….
